OrCAD PSpice. Анализ электрических цепей
Шрифт:
Обратите внимание, что ширина полосы частот при замкнутой обратной связи CLBW=ftβ, а
В нашем примере β=10/250=0,04 и ftβ=40 кГц. Это приближенное значение находится в хорошем согласии с нашей моделью, которая дала f=39,33 кГц для частоты, при которой происходит снижение на 3 дБ. В качестве дальнейшего исследования модели измените значение резистора обратной связи на R2=15 кОм, и снова проведите анализ. Убедитесь, что значение Аmid=7,959 дБ и f3дБ=393,6 кГц. А какое значение для f3дБ даст использование приближенной формулы и нового значения β?
Использование подсхем при моделировании операционных усилителей
Модель, которую мы использовали для ОУ в предыдущем примере, содержит достаточно много элементов, поэтому целесообразно оформить ее в виде подсхемы (subcircuit). При этом мы одновременно познакомимся с этим инструментом PSpice. Модель показана на рис. 5.13.
Рис. 5.13. Подсхема ОУ с обозначением узлов
Отметим, что узлы и элементы маркированы с использованием символов нижнего регистра. Это условие не обязательно, так как PSpice не учитывает регистра. То есть верхний и нижний регистры могут взаимозаменяться. Однако чтобы проще было идентифицировать подсхему и ее элементы, мы выбрали для меток узлов нижний регистр. Мы назначили номера и символы таким образом, чтобы не путать внутренние узлы подсхемы с внешними. Подсхема задается как независимая часть входного файла, но не является законченным входным файлом сама по себе. Команды описания подсхемы будут следующими:
Описание любой подсхемы начинается с команды .subckt. Первым элементом списка является имя подсхемы, которое в данном случае записано как opamp. Оно сопровождается набором узлов, которые связывают подсхему с остальной частью входного файла. Вы можете думать о них как об узлах, доступных для внешней части схемы. В данном примере — это узлы т, р и v0. Опорный узел всегда обозначается как 0, и его не обязательно включать в перечень узлов.
Элементы в подсхеме задаются обычным способом. Так как подсхема не является законченным входным файлом, она может содержать «висящие» узлы. Команды ввода элементов выровнены для упрощения их идентификации, но это не обязательно. Команда .ends отмечает конец описания подсхемы.
Теперь мы готовы рассмотреть новую версию анализа ОУ с использованием подсхемы. Законченная схема показана на рис. 5.9 и повторена на рис. 5.14. После приобретения некоторого опыта вы, возможно, захотите рисовать подсхему в виде прямоугольника или треугольника. Как видно из рисунка, узлы m, р и v0 имеют новые обозначения. Они получили метки 1, 2 и 3 соответственно. Чтобы использовать подсхему, основной входной файл должен содержать команду ввода подсхемы:
Рис. 5.14. Модель, показывающая подсхему в составе общей схемы для вызова
Здесь X обозначает обращение к подсхеме. Узлы 1, 2 и 3 приводятся в порядке, соответствующем узлам m, p и v0 в подсхеме. Это позволяет подсхеме получать обозначение узла, передаваемое от основного схемного файла. Инструкция также содержит имя подсхемы opamp. Теперь рассмотрим весь входной файл:
Выполните анализ и убедитесь, что он дает тот же результат, что и предыдущий анализ, в котором подсхема не использовалась.
Дифференцирующие схемы на базе операционного усилителя
Дифференцирующая схема, построенная на базе идеального ОУ, показана на рис. 5.15, а. Поскольку инвертирующий вход заземлен, vc=v. Легко показать, что при R=0,5 Ом
Таким образом, когда входное напряжение имеет форму треугольника, выходное напряжение должно быть прямоугольным (рис. 5.15, б). Используйте приведенный ниже входной файл, чтобы проверить этот вывод:
(a)
(b)
Рис. 5.15. Схема дифференциатора на базе ОУ
Выполните анализ и убедитесь, что выходное напряжение имеет прямоугольную форму с чередующейся полярностью и значениями напряжения от -1,0 В до +1 В. Эта инверсия происходит также и в ОУ. Постройте на одном графике временные зависимости для v(3) и v(1). Сравните ваши результаты с рис. 5.16. Обратите внимание, что команда входного файла для введения С не должна быть задана как
Рис. 5.16. График входного и выходного напряжений в схеме на рис. 5.15
В этом случае символ F будет восприниматься программой не как фарада, а как префикс и команда будет задавать значение 2 fF (фемтофарады). Если вы хотите, чтобы в записи всегда отражались единицы измерения, то вы можете использовать альтернативную форму записи:
Интегрирующие схемы ha базе операционных усилителей
Устройства, дуальные дифференцирующим схемам, называются интегрирующими схемами. На рис. 5.17, а резистор R и конденсатор С поменялись местами относительно рис. 5.15, а. Новая схема и есть интегратор (инвертирующий). Чтобы проверить его свойства, используйте входное напряжение (форма которого показана на рис. 5.17, б) и входной файл: